Mo was the best. He lived a life full of kindness, laughter and love. He loved God, loved people and loved basketball. He inspired those around him with his sincere smile and infectious laugh.
When he was 19 years old, he gave his life to Jesus and he was forever changed. His faith was contagious. Then, 7 months later, on the day he was going to play his first home game for Modesto Junior College, a car hit his car head on. For 10 years after the accident he lived in a comatose state and still was inspiring everyone around him. He inspired us to live with hope and to always pray for a miracle.
On September 4th at 3:30 pm, Mo took his last breath here on earth and went home with his Savior. His life will truly be remembered as he has left such a meaningful mark on so many people's lives. Mauricio Fernando Alaniz is a legend and we thank God for the privilege of knowing and loving him.
